After wrapping up her role in Stranger Things, Sadie Sink is making headlines as she joins the Marvel Cinematic Universe for the upcoming film Spider-Man: Brand New Day. Fans and media are abuzz with speculation about her character, especially given her striking red hair and the secrecy surrounding her role. Sink addressed the rumors, emphasizing that hair color can change and that fans should wait for official reveals. She also dismissed some of the more outlandish theories, including the idea that she might be playing X-Men’s Jean Grey, noting that such ideas predate her involvement. As of November 2025, her casting has generated significant excitement, with industry insiders suggesting her role could be pivotal in the MCU’s evolving multiverse storyline. In addition to her Marvel debut, Sadie Sink is set to make her West End stage debut in Shakespeare’s Romeo & Juliet alongside Noah Jupe, directed by Robert Icke, marking a notable expansion of her acting repertoire.
